Toedscool wasn't as arbitrary as you made it seem. They're based on wood ear mushroom. Its thin, wrinkly, doming shape and smushy texture brings to mind not only ears, but the bell of a jellyfish. The japanese word for this fungus is even kikurage, or "tree jellyfish"

While the games never officially refer to them as Convergent, one of Wiglett's dex entries pretty much describes convergent evolution: "Though it looks like Diglett, Wiglett is an entirely different species. The resemblance seems to be a coincidental result of environmental adaptation." I think the general idea is still "they have similar niches so they evolve to have a somewhat similar body" (in this case Wig and Dig being mons that spend most of their time underground), but taking a lot more creative liberty than irl
